关闭窗口的命令是什么?

Fin*_*son 6 xorg keyboard shortcut-keys

我想设置一个键盘快捷键来关闭 Ubuntu 16.04 中的当前窗口。我知道alt+f4已经这样做了,如果我愿意,我可以重新定义这个快捷方式,但我真正想要的是添加一个额外的快捷方式来执行相同的功能。

原因是; 我有一个没有指定功能键的键盘(60%)。相反,功能键是通过键盘快捷键激活的,该快捷键在数字键和功能键之间切换数字键行(例如,4tof4和反之亦然)。

我养成了使用快速关闭窗口的习惯,alt+f4无论我处于功能键还是数字键模式,我都希望它能够正常工作,但是在设置新的键盘快捷键时似乎无法在命令字段中找到应该输入的内容.

我为我的特定问题找到了一个很好的解决方法,并将其发布在下面的答案中。仍然对更优雅的解决方案持开放态度。

编辑:澄清一下,机器正在运行 X11。

gui*_*erc 5

wmctrl -c <win>

   wmctrl - interact with a EWMH/NetWM compatible X Window Manager.

   -c <WIN>
          Close the window <WIN> gracefully.
Run Code Online (Sandbox Code Playgroud)

来自man wmctrl。但请注意:我使用 XFCE,所以没有在默认的 Ubuntu 16.04 中对 Unity 进行测试,如果在 17.10 以上使用 Wayland,我不希望它工作)